User Research Intern - Product Discovery

Schneider Innovations
Monrovia, CA

About Schneider Innovations

Schneider Innovations is a fast-growing global company focused on building and scaling product brands across consumer health, medical supplies, industrial supplies, and personal protective equipment (PPE) categories. Our products are distributed throughout North America through multiple channels, including major retail, e-commerce platforms, and institutional buyers. 

What makes our approach different is how we develop products. Rather than relying purely on intuition, we combine  data intelligence , user insight , and rapid market testing  to evaluate product opportunities and bring better ideas to market faster. 

Our long-term vision is to build a next-generation  AI Product Marketing Lab  — a system where data, user research, and market feedback continuously inform how products are designed, positioned, and launched. 

About the Role

Our team operates an active pipeline of product concepts across multiple categories. Before any idea moves toward development, it must pass through a structured discovery process that combines user research, concept testing, and early market validation .

We are looking for interns to help support this process by conducting structured user interviews and gathering insights from potential users. The role focuses on executing research activities that help the team understand user needs, reactions to product concepts, and potential market signals.

Interns will work with prepared interview frameworks, scripts, and tools provided by the team. The role is primarily execution-focused: conducting interviews, organizing feedback, and summarizing insights that support product and business decisions.

This internship sits at the intersection of user research, product development, and market insight , and provides exposure to how companies evaluate product ideas before bringing them to market.

 

What You Will Do

  • Source and recruit potential interview participants based on provided criteria 
  • Conduct structured user interviews using prepared research scripts 
  • Facilitate conversations to ensure relevant topics are covered 
  • Capture and document interview responses and observations 
  • Organize qualitative feedback across multiple interviews 
  • Code and categorize user responses into recurring themes 
  • Prepare summaries of key insights for the product team 
  • Optionally assist with identifying patterns or signals that inform product decisions 

Requirements

  • Currently pursuing or recently completed a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Psychology, Communication Studies, Sociology, Political Science, Business, Marketing, Economics, Data / Business Analytics, or a related field
  • Strong interest in user research, human behavior, product development, or market insight
  • Comfortable speaking with new people and facilitating structured conversations or interviews
  • Strong listening skills with the ability to capture and document information clearly and accurately
  • Able to follow a prepared research framework while responding naturally to the flow of a conversation
  • Organized and detail-oriented when recording responses, observations, and interview notes
  • Curious and analytical mindset when interpreting qualitative feedback and identifying patterns

Preferred but not required:

  • Experience conducting interviews, surveys, usability studies, or research projects (academic or professional)
  • Experience working as a Research Assistant or participating in academic research involving human subjects
  • Familiarity with survey or research tools such as Qualtrics, Google Forms, or similar platforms
  • Prior coursework or projects involving research methods, market research, or behavioral studies

Benefits

  • Paid internship $18-20/hr, 20-30hr/week
  • Hands-on experience conducting real-world user research and product discovery
  • Exposure to how companies evaluate product ideas and market opportunities
  • Opportunity to observe how product, marketing, and business strategy decisions are informed by user insight
  • Experience working within an AI-driven product marketing environment
  • Location: Monrovia, CA (on-site)
  • Internship Duration: Expected to run from March 23 to June 3 , unless extended or concluded earlier depending on project needs
